Output 43660883846e318f4cfff457aa618f143e16f81b3d7edf058113dd2f3f46acfc:0

value
42907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bde43e34cf81bb317f54e4be607fc56da63effa OP_EQUAL
address
34ENRyjzBTpWMkG2kkB2F94E1fKyckShXu
transaction
43660883846e318f4cfff457aa618f143e16f81b3d7edf058113dd2f3f46acfc
spent
true